SAN DIEGO - Kelsi Dantu scored two penalty kick goals to help lead San Diego to its fifth consecutive victory, defeating LMU, 3-2, on Thursday night at Torero Stadium.
The victory keeps the Toreros (6-8, 4-0 WCC) atop the WCC leaderboard with Pepperdine before the two sides square off Saturday night at 7 p.m. (PT).
Dantu created the first penalty kick opportunity just 3:32 into the game. She carried with pace into the penalty box and had her legs clipped from behind. She stepped to the spot and buried a shot to the lower left corner of the goal.
Natalie Copenhaver created the second penalty kick opportunity for the Toreros, dribbling between two Lions (6-6-3, 1-4 WCC) before being taken down in the 61st minute. Dantu stepped to the spot for a second time and slotted a perfectly-placed shot to the bottom right corner of the goal.
Dantu is second on the team with four goals on the season.

Summer Mason continued to tear through conference competition and registered her team-leading eighth goal of the season. Halle Walls sent a through-ball from the Toreros own half through the center of the field. Mason blew by a pair of defenders, beat LMU's goalkeeper to the 50-50 ball and tapped in a shot to the center of the goal.
Mason has scored six goals during the Toreros five-game winning-streak.
Tara Meier helped lead a strong defensive performance by the Toreros.
USD's defense - consisting primarily of Courtney Coate, Natalie Copenhaver, Abby King and Tara Meier - did well to limit the Lions scoring opportunities. LMU generated 17 shots but only seven were on frame. Goalkeeper, Amber Michel, made five saves and was excellent coming off her line to clear away crosses and long-balls over the top.
USD will look to extend its winning-streak on Saturday when it plays host to Pepperdine at 7 p.m. It will be Senior Night and the Toreros will honor its three graduating seniors, Coate, Meier and Ally Ocon.
